Ridho laksono syd100487. Why Facebook has many casual games But small amount of game that really...

Preview:

Citation preview

SHARDS HUNTER UNITY3D GAME IN FACEBOOK

Ridho laksonosyd100487

Why

Facebook has many casual games But small amount of game that

really doing activities with friends in real time

Profit opportunies

In game item Players will buy items with real world

currency to enhance their character In game currency

Player will buy game currency with real world currency

Genre and features

Multiplayer 1-4 player coop 2d/3d platform Online action adventure == casual mmorpg

Browser based games Integrated with facebook

Profile box Sending facebook gift and notifications

Key Features

1-4 multiplayer coop mission Upgradeable items Skills Character customization Character development Game currency

Inspiration

Mafia wars

Inspiration

Treasure island

Inspiration

contra

Features : Notifications/profile box

Sample : paintball 3d

Sample : enercities

Story

after meteor shower fell down to earth, the meteors scattered through all over the world. Recently some researchers found out that the shards are priceless and beautiful.

Game play

Player plays as a treasure hunter, and they can collect items by fighting monsters, and finishing missions.

Those item can be used to upgrade the character or give them as gift to other player.

Game Mock Ups

Game Mock Ups

Game Mock Ups

Game Mock Ups

Why am I doing this project and why you should allow me

Web development experiences Network programming experiences

Why me :Web development experiences

HTML, CSS Web services : JSON,

SOAP JavaScript

framework: jQuery, mootools

Framework codeigniter

Joomla

Drupal

Why me :Web development experiences

HTML CSSJquery

Website for Project management 1st trimester 2010

Why me : Programming experience

Csharp : Math Demo project in 3rd trimester XNA, windows Form

Networking : Raknet, Winsock

Client Side Requirement

Unity3d game engine web plug-in Browser, Firefox, safari, IE, opera

Server Side Requirement

Game server : Beam server 2 (Csharp )

Mysql – Database

Stateless server : Lighttpd Http Server, this alongside

with PHP will server html needed for client’s web browser to display unity instance.

PHP

Game design

Game design prototype.docx

Staged Delivery

Getting Technical : Facebook API

Graph API Friends list, User profile

oAuth authentication system

Linux VPS : ubuntu 10.4 64 bit Serves html, json services, with http Serves game server with UDP

Installed appsLighttpd, mono, php, mysql

Getting Technical : Game server

Getting technical : application flow